A Ward 3 Councillor-elect is asking the residents of Greater Moncton leave their back porch light on tonight.
Bryan Butler says this is a gesture to remember our fallen heroes who died on June 4th, seven years ago.
In 2014, RCMP Constable Fabrice Gevaudan, Constable Dave Ross and Constable Doug Larche were killed and Constables Eric Dubois and Darlene Goguen were injured in a shooting incident in the community.
A monument honouring the three fallen officers was erected in Riverfront Park on the second anniversary of the tragedy.
